Transaction aefd526d1a2b399df917c977f530e86fcff44fc4f8e88ddfb14467a3b2941bf6
1 Input
2 Outputs
- aefd526d1a2b399df917c977f530e86fcff44fc4f8e88ddfb14467a3b2941bf6:0
- aefd526d1a2b399df917c977f530e86fcff44fc4f8e88ddfb14467a3b2941bf6:1
value 435969
address 17Xh9QxeB318ZuZNpmm6wiLFs8JshooHzj
value 170713565
address 1DV2hg7iLoECaL29sxzLpwfzpHKNJoi5vE